"Old Swan" meaning in English

See Old Swan in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

Etymology: Apparently named after a former public house named the Three Swans. There is now another pub named the Old Swan. Head templates: {{en-proper noun|head=Old Swan}} Old Swan
  1. A suburb of Liverpool, Merseyside, England, east of the city centre (OS grid ref SJ3991). Categories (place): Places in England, Places in Liverpool, Places in Merseyside, England, Suburbs in Merseyside, England
